Opposition Flays KCR On New Districts

Telangana Congress Legislature Party leader K Jana Reddy and other Opposition leaders slammed the Chief Minister over the districts' re-organisation.
Hyderabad | 3rd September 2016
Telangana Congress Legislature Party leader K Jana Reddy today alleged that State Chief Minister K Chandrashekar Rao had failed to fulfill the assurances that he had given to the people during the 2014 elections.

Several Congress leaders including Reddy and TPCC working president Mallu Bhatti Vikramarka, and CPI leader Chada Venkat Reddy visited the ongoing two-day hunger strike camp of Gadwal MLA D K Aruna and former TPCC chief Ponnala Laxmaiah on Saturday, and delivered brief speeches.

Speaking on the occasion, Reddy urged the gathering to question the government without fear of persecution, and promised that the Congress would back them up.

The Congress leader pointed out that the Telangana government had not yet fulfilled several of its key election promises including the KG-to-PG scheme, the double-bedroom house scheme and the promise of alloting 12% reservations for Muslims.

He also claimed that the government was misleading the people in the name of the districts' re-organisation. He said that the new districts should be created based on geography, government facilities, population and history instead of on Party representations or political agendas.

TPCC working president Mallu Bhatti Vikramarka also weighed in on the districts issue, and demanded that the State government announce clear guidelines on the re-organisation.

He said that the Congress would extend its cooperation to the hunger strike and the movement, and promised that it would not stay silent if the TRS-led government created the districts based on political expediency.

Speaking next, CPI State secretary Chada Venkat Reddy said that his Party would not accept KCR's unilateral decisions on the re-organization of mandals, revenue divisions or districts. He opined that it should be done scientifically.

The government should consider the aspirations of the people, too, while creating new districts, he added.
